    • RE: 3d view feature on the 3d Warehouse

      I was looking at doing something similar to this on our site.. There is an opensource flash library called 'Papervision 3D' which has support for collada files.. so in theory you could create a flash widget which would load a collada version of the 3d model and let you zoom and pan around it at will πŸ˜„

      Obviously this would only work for smaller models, but that is the focus of our site. Maybe sometime soon! πŸ˜‰

    • RE: Mapping Textures
      1. Import the texture into your library (see Sketchup help)

      2. Ensure that the dimensions are correct under the 'Edit Texture' dialog box. For example if you have a brick texture which has 5 bricks across then the it would likely be set at 750mm (150*5).

      3. Apply the texture to your surface like any other with the paint bucket tool.

      4. Right click on the face and select 'Texture > Position'

      5. Use the four grips to position / rotate and skew your texture.

      I haven't used vue but sketchup exports standard UV map information and therefore you should not need to remap in vue.

    • RE: Line weight.

      It should also be noted that simply exporting at a higher resolution than the default will result in the appearance of lines being thinner. Try putting your export resolution up to at least 3000px wide - this is available by clicking 'options' when you do 2d export to JPG.
